Northrop Grumman is seeking Mission Assurance Engineers. This position will be located on-site at our Aeronautics Systems sector in Melbourne, FL.

The qualified candidate will learn to execute and oversee quality-first technical support, independent of Engineering, through early intervention. Learn and deliver focused efforts in design review, nonconforming material processing, incoming material, production control, product evaluation and reliability, manufacturing, flight operations, research and development as they apply to the mission assurance statement of work.

Roles and Responsibilities:

  • Learn, develop and deliver malfunction and corrective action reports to hold manufacturing accountable for root cause and corrective action deliverables.
  • Understand and review all necessary product and system documentation to ensure process compliance and requirement needs are met.
  • Work closely with mission assurance team and program partners to recognize and validate flow of program requirements.
  • Study, plan, and develop the required processes to identify potential product performance impacts as early as possible.
  • Support product development engagement through oversight of processes, procedures and standard adherence to ensure that product design continuously meets customer requirements.
  • Participate in product qualification testing and seek guidance when needed.
  • Support program integration testing via test procedure review, test witnessing, troubleshooting and buy off.
  • Execute Mission Assurance functions by learning compliance review of Supplier Data Requirements Lists, Acceptance Test Procedures, Qualification Test Procedures, Supplier Statement of Work, Program Specifications.
  • Assist in audits to identify deficiencies, nonconformances, and negative performance trends and failures.
  • Develop high level organizational skills to support concurrent taskings along with cultivating strong computer skills to achieve a high level of pro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ite.

Basic Qualifications:

Basic Qualifications for an Associate Mission Assurance Engineer:

A candidate must meet ALL of the below criteria. The candidate must:

  • Be completing or has completed their Bachelor’s degree from an accredited institution by August 2026
  • Be majoring in or having majored in Aerospace Engineering, Aeronautical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Electrical Engineering, or other related STEM degree program
  • Be able to obtain and maintain a U.S. Government security clearance (U.S. citizenship is a pre-requisite) as well as Special Access Program clearance within a reasonable period of time, as determined by the company to meet its business needs.
  • Interim Secret clearance needed prior to start date

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Have an overall cumulative GPA of 3.00/4.0 or higher
  • Knowledge in Engineering, Manufacturing, Program integration
  • Basic understanding of AS9100 standards
  • Basic insight into Lean Six Sigma and Root Cause Analysis processes
  • Drawing review and modeling tool experience (CAD), such as Siemens NX
  • Active U.S. Government Secret security clearance
